Requirements:

Key Responsibilities

  • Instruction & Student Support
    • Provide direct instruction to students in individual, small group, and inclusion settings based on IEP goals
    • Adapt curriculum and teaching strategies to meet diverse learning needs
    • Implement accommodations and modifications as outlined in students’ IEPs
  • IEP Development & Implementation
    • Develop, write, and maintain IEPs in compliance with IDEA and state guidelines
    • Collect and analyze data to monitor student progress and adjust instruction accordingly
    • Conduct assessments for initial, annual, and triennial evaluations
  • Collaboration & Communication
    • Work closely with general education teachers, paraprofessionals, related service providers, and administration to support inclusive practices
    • Communicate regularly with families regarding student progress and services
    • Participate in and lead IEP meetings, ensuring parents and team members are fully informed
  • Compliance & Documentation
    • Maintain accurate records of student progress, services, and communication
    • Ensure all timelines, reports, and documentation meet legal and district requirements
    • Support the school in maintaining compliance during audits and reviews

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ree in Special Education or related field (Master’s degree preferred)
  • Valid Arizona Special Education teaching certificate or eligibility to obtain one
  • Knowledge of IDEA, state-specific special education regulations, and instructional best practices
  • Strong classroom management, organizational, and communication skills
  • Proficiency with IEP software platforms and educational technology tools

Preferred Skills & Attributes

  • Experience working in a K–8 setting
  • Experience with co-teaching models
  • A growth mindset, commitment and passion for serving all learners
  • Bilingual (English/Spanish) is a plus

Work Environment

  • Full-time position located at Freedom Academy (K–8 campus)
  • Classroom setting with occasional off-site meetings or professional development
  • May include occasional evening IEP meetings or school events

Compensation details: 45000-62000 Yearly Salary
